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> de.comp.editoren > #360 > unrolled thread

[VIM] Statuszeile ruiniert

Started byAndreas Kohlbach <ank@spamfence.net>
First post2021-08-24 22:13 -0400
Last post2021-08-26 20:13 -0400
Articles 9 — 2 participants

Back to article view | Back to de.comp.editoren


Contents

  [VIM] Statuszeile ruiniert Andreas Kohlbach <ank@spamfence.net> - 2021-08-24 22:13 -0400
    Re: [VIM] Statuszeile ruiniert nospam_2021@efbe.prima.de - 2021-08-25 09:36 +0200
      Re: [VIM] Statuszeile ruiniert Andreas Kohlbach <ank@spamfence.net> - 2021-08-25 11:54 -0400
        Re: [VIM] Statuszeile ruiniert nospam_2021@efbe.prima.de - 2021-08-25 21:18 +0200
          Re: [VIM] Statuszeile ruiniert Andreas Kohlbach <ank@spamfence.net> - 2021-08-25 15:52 -0400
            Re: [VIM] Statuszeile ruiniert nospam_2021@efbe.prima.de - 2021-08-26 11:19 +0200
              Re: [VIM] Statuszeile ruiniert Andreas Kohlbach <ank@spamfence.net> - 2021-08-26 12:32 -0400
                Re: [VIM] Statuszeile ruiniert nospam_2021@efbe.prima.de - 2021-08-26 20:37 +0200
                  Re: [VIM] Statuszeile ruiniert Andreas Kohlbach <ank@spamfence.net> - 2021-08-26 20:13 -0400

#360 — [VIM] Statuszeile ruiniert

FromAndreas Kohlbach <ank@spamfence.net>
Date2021-08-24 22:13 -0400
Subject[VIM] Statuszeile ruiniert
Message-ID<874kbe2rwp.fsf@usenet.ankman.de>
Seit Langem zeigte VIM in der Statuszeile die Anzahl der Zeilen und die
aktuelle Position des Cursors an, bis ich auf die Idee kam, (auch) die
Wortzahl anzuzeigen. Der eingefügte Schnipsel in die vimrc zeigte dann
aber *nur* die Wortzahl an.

set statusline+=%{wordcount().words}\ words
set laststatus=2    " enables the statusline.

Nun war mir die aktuelle Zeilenzahl und Position des Cursors doch wieder
wichtiger, dass ich beide Zeilen auskommentierte. Nun wird nichts mehr
angezeigt.

Wie bekomme ich die Wortzahl und Position wieder? Besser die beiden, plus
die Anzahl aller Worte?

Alles was ich ergoogelte funktionierte nicht.
-- 
Andreas

[toc] | [next] | [standalone]


#361

Fromnospam_2021@efbe.prima.de
Date2021-08-25 09:36 +0200
Message-ID<ioma8qFr9baU1@mid.individual.net>
In reply to#360
Am 25.08.21 um 04:13 schrieb Andreas Kohlbach:
> Seit Langem zeigte VIM in der Statuszeile die Anzahl der Zeilen und die
> aktuelle Position des Cursors an, bis ich auf die Idee kam, (auch) die
> Wortzahl anzuzeigen. Der eingefügte Schnipsel in die vimrc zeigte dann
> aber *nur* die Wortzahl an.
> 
> set statusline+=%{wordcount().words}\ words
> set laststatus=2    " enables the statusline.
> 
> Nun war mir die aktuelle Zeilenzahl und Position des Cursors doch wieder
> wichtiger, dass ich beide Zeilen auskommentierte. Nun wird nichts mehr
> angezeigt.
Wenn du laststatus nicht setzt, gibt es auch keine statusline

> 
> Wie bekomme ich die Wortzahl und Position wieder? Besser die beiden, plus
> die Anzahl aller Worte?
> 
> Alles was ich ergoogelte funktionierte nicht.
Versuch einfach mal die VIM Hilfe

:h statusline
:h status-line

HTH
Frank

[toc] | [prev] | [next] | [standalone]


#362

FromAndreas Kohlbach <ank@spamfence.net>
Date2021-08-25 11:54 -0400
Message-ID<871r6h34gr.fsf@usenet.ankman.de>
In reply to#361
On Wed, 25 Aug 2021 09:36:58 +0200, nospam_2021@efbe.prima.de wrote:
>
> Am 25.08.21 um 04:13 schrieb Andreas Kohlbach:
>> Seit Langem zeigte VIM in der Statuszeile die Anzahl der Zeilen und die
>> aktuelle Position des Cursors an, bis ich auf die Idee kam, (auch) die
>> Wortzahl anzuzeigen. Der eingefügte Schnipsel in die vimrc zeigte dann
>> aber *nur* die Wortzahl an.
>> set statusline+=%{wordcount().words}\ words
>> set laststatus=2    " enables the statusline.
>> Nun war mir die aktuelle Zeilenzahl und Position des Cursors doch
>> wieder
>> wichtiger, dass ich beide Zeilen auskommentierte. Nun wird nichts mehr
>> angezeigt.
> Wenn du laststatus nicht setzt, gibt es auch keine statusline

Auch wenn nur "set laststatus=2" allein gesetzt ist, wird keine angezeigt.

>> Wie bekomme ich die Wortzahl und Position wieder? Besser die beiden,
>> plus
>> die Anzahl aller Worte?
>> Alles was ich ergoogelte funktionierte nicht.
> Versuch einfach mal die VIM Hilfe
>
> :h statusline
> :h status-line

Danke.
-- 
Andreas

[toc] | [prev] | [next] | [standalone]


#363

Fromnospam_2021@efbe.prima.de
Date2021-08-25 21:18 +0200
Message-ID<ionjcjF4ghaU1@mid.individual.net>
In reply to#362
Am 25.08.21 um 17:54 schrieb Andreas Kohlbach:
> On Wed, 25 Aug 2021 09:36:58 +0200, nospam_2021@efbe.prima.de wrote:
>>
>> Am 25.08.21 um 04:13 schrieb Andreas Kohlbach:
>>> Seit Langem zeigte VIM in der Statuszeile die Anzahl der Zeilen und die
>>> aktuelle Position des Cursors an, bis ich auf die Idee kam, (auch) die
>>> Wortzahl anzuzeigen. Der eingefügte Schnipsel in die vimrc zeigte dann
>>> aber *nur* die Wortzahl an.
>>> set statusline+=%{wordcount().words}\ words
>>> set laststatus=2    " enables the statusline.
>>> Nun war mir die aktuelle Zeilenzahl und Position des Cursors doch
>>> wieder
>>> wichtiger, dass ich beide Zeilen auskommentierte. Nun wird nichts mehr
>>> angezeigt.
>> Wenn du laststatus nicht setzt, gibt es auch keine statusline
> 
> Auch wenn nur "set laststatus=2" allein gesetzt ist, wird keine angezeigt.

Was passiert mit
:set statusline?

Meine statusline in vimrc
set statusline=%F%m%r%h%w%=(Z\ %l\/%L,\ Sp\ %c)\ %P

ergibt z.B.
~/.vim/vimrc[+]                     (Z 142/264, Sp 1) 55%
> 
>>> Wie bekomme ich die Wortzahl und Position wieder? Besser die beiden,
>>> plus
>>> die Anzahl aller Worte?
>>> Alles was ich ergoogelte funktionierte nicht.
>> Versuch einfach mal die VIM Hilfe
>>
>> :h statusline
>> :h status-line

[toc] | [prev] | [next] | [standalone]


#364

FromAndreas Kohlbach <ank@spamfence.net>
Date2021-08-25 15:52 -0400
Message-ID<87pmu11evh.fsf@usenet.ankman.de>
In reply to#363
On Wed, 25 Aug 2021 21:18:42 +0200, nospam_2021@efbe.prima.de wrote:
>
> Am 25.08.21 um 17:54 schrieb Andreas Kohlbach:
>> On Wed, 25 Aug 2021 09:36:58 +0200, nospam_2021@efbe.prima.de wrote:
>>>
>>> Am 25.08.21 um 04:13 schrieb Andreas Kohlbach:
>>>> Seit Langem zeigte VIM in der Statuszeile die Anzahl der Zeilen und die
>>>> aktuelle Position des Cursors an, bis ich auf die Idee kam, (auch) die
>>>> Wortzahl anzuzeigen. Der eingefügte Schnipsel in die vimrc zeigte dann
>>>> aber *nur* die Wortzahl an.
>>>> set statusline+=%{wordcount().words}\ words
>>>> set laststatus=2    " enables the statusline.
>>>> Nun war mir die aktuelle Zeilenzahl und Position des Cursors doch
>>>> wieder
>>>> wichtiger, dass ich beide Zeilen auskommentierte. Nun wird nichts mehr
>>>> angezeigt.
>>> Wenn du laststatus nicht setzt, gibt es auch keine statusline
>> 
>> Auch wenn nur "set laststatus=2" allein gesetzt ist, wird keine angezeigt.
>
> Was passiert mit
> :set statusline?
>
> Meine statusline in vimrc
> set statusline=%F%m%r%h%w%=(Z\ %l\/%L,\ Sp\ %c)\ %P
>
> ergibt z.B.
> ~/.vim/vimrc[+]                     (Z 142/264, Sp 1) 55%

Invertiert:

[No Name][+]

wenn auch

set laststatus=2

gesetzt ist. Sonst gar nichts.
-- 
Andreas

[toc] | [prev] | [next] | [standalone]


#365

Fromnospam_2021@efbe.prima.de
Date2021-08-26 11:19 +0200
Message-ID<iop4lcFdd03U1@mid.individual.net>
In reply to#364
Am 25.08.21 um 21:52 schrieb Andreas Kohlbach:
> On Wed, 25 Aug 2021 21:18:42 +0200, nospam_2021@efbe.prima.de wrote:
>>
>> Am 25.08.21 um 17:54 schrieb Andreas Kohlbach:
>>> On Wed, 25 Aug 2021 09:36:58 +0200, nospam_2021@efbe.prima.de wrote:
>>>>
>>>> Am 25.08.21 um 04:13 schrieb Andreas Kohlbach:
>>>>> Seit Langem zeigte VIM in der Statuszeile die Anzahl der Zeilen und die
>>>>> aktuelle Position des Cursors an, bis ich auf die Idee kam, (auch) die
>>>>> Wortzahl anzuzeigen. Der eingefügte Schnipsel in die vimrc zeigte dann
>>>>> aber *nur* die Wortzahl an.
>>>>> set statusline+=%{wordcount().words}\ words
>>>>> set laststatus=2    " enables the statusline.
>>>>> Nun war mir die aktuelle Zeilenzahl und Position des Cursors doch
>>>>> wieder
>>>>> wichtiger, dass ich beide Zeilen auskommentierte. Nun wird nichts mehr
>>>>> angezeigt.
>>>> Wenn du laststatus nicht setzt, gibt es auch keine statusline
>>>
>>> Auch wenn nur "set laststatus=2" allein gesetzt ist, wird keine angezeigt.
>>
>> Was passiert mit
>> :set statusline?
>>
>> Meine statusline in vimrc
>> set statusline=%F%m%r%h%w%=(Z\ %l\/%L,\ Sp\ %c)\ %P
>>
>> ergibt z.B.
>> ~/.vim/vimrc[+]                     (Z 142/264, Sp 1) 55%
> 
> Invertiert:
> 
> [No Name][+]
> 
> wenn auch
> 
> set laststatus=2
> 
> gesetzt ist. Sonst gar nichts.
> 
Natürlich.

Welche VIM Version setzt du ein?
Bei mir VIM 8.2 klappt deine Änderung.

[toc] | [prev] | [next] | [standalone]


#366

FromAndreas Kohlbach <ank@spamfence.net>
Date2021-08-26 12:32 -0400
Message-ID<87y28oyxn2.fsf@usenet.ankman.de>
In reply to#365
On Thu, 26 Aug 2021 11:19:40 +0200, nospam_2021@efbe.prima.de wrote:
>
> Am 25.08.21 um 21:52 schrieb Andreas Kohlbach:
>> On Wed, 25 Aug 2021 21:18:42 +0200, nospam_2021@efbe.prima.de wrote:
>>>
>>> Am 25.08.21 um 17:54 schrieb Andreas Kohlbach:
>>>> On Wed, 25 Aug 2021 09:36:58 +0200, nospam_2021@efbe.prima.de wrote:
>>>>>
>>>>> Am 25.08.21 um 04:13 schrieb Andreas Kohlbach:
>>>>>> Seit Langem zeigte VIM in der Statuszeile die Anzahl der Zeilen und die
>>>>>> aktuelle Position des Cursors an, bis ich auf die Idee kam, (auch) die
>>>>>> Wortzahl anzuzeigen. Der eingefügte Schnipsel in die vimrc zeigte dann
>>>>>> aber *nur* die Wortzahl an.
>>>>>> set statusline+=%{wordcount().words}\ words
>>>>>> set laststatus=2    " enables the statusline.
>>>>>> Nun war mir die aktuelle Zeilenzahl und Position des Cursors doch
>>>>>> wieder
>>>>>> wichtiger, dass ich beide Zeilen auskommentierte. Nun wird nichts mehr
>>>>>> angezeigt.
>>>>> Wenn du laststatus nicht setzt, gibt es auch keine statusline
>>>>
>>>> Auch wenn nur "set laststatus=2" allein gesetzt ist, wird keine angezeigt.
>>>
>>> Was passiert mit
>>> :set statusline?
>>>
>>> Meine statusline in vimrc
>>> set statusline=%F%m%r%h%w%=(Z\ %l\/%L,\ Sp\ %c)\ %P
>>>
>>> ergibt z.B.
>>> ~/.vim/vimrc[+]                     (Z 142/264, Sp 1) 55%
>> Invertiert:
>> [No Name][+]
>> wenn auch
>> set laststatus=2
>> gesetzt ist. Sonst gar nichts.
>> 
> Natürlich.
>
> Welche VIM Version setzt du ein?
> Bei mir VIM 8.2 klappt deine Änderung.

| Vi IMproved 8.2 (2019 Dec 12, compiled Mar 02 2021 02:58:09)

Das scheint alt. Aber ist so neu, wie Debian (Testing) es vorhält.

Vermutlich müsste ich die vimrc entfernen. Unter einem anderen
User-Account zeigt VIM die Zahl der Zeilen und Charakter an.

Egal, ich ignoriere das. Will nicht wirklich zu viel Zeit dafür
aufbringen. Dachte, es gäbe eine *einfache* Lösung.
-- 
Andreas

[toc] | [prev] | [next] | [standalone]


#367

Fromnospam_2021@efbe.prima.de
Date2021-08-26 20:37 +0200
Message-ID<ioq5biFjjhoU1@mid.individual.net>
In reply to#366
Am 26.08.21 um 18:32 schrieb Andreas Kohlbach:
> On Thu, 26 Aug 2021 11:19:40 +0200, nospam_2021@efbe.prima.de wrote:
>>
>> Am 25.08.21 um 21:52 schrieb Andreas Kohlbach:
>>> On Wed, 25 Aug 2021 21:18:42 +0200, nospam_2021@efbe.prima.de wrote:
>>>>
>>>> Am 25.08.21 um 17:54 schrieb Andreas Kohlbach:
>>>>> On Wed, 25 Aug 2021 09:36:58 +0200, nospam_2021@efbe.prima.de wrote:
>>>>>>
>>>>>> Am 25.08.21 um 04:13 schrieb Andreas Kohlbach:
>>>>>>> Seit Langem zeigte VIM in der Statuszeile die Anzahl der Zeilen und die
>>>>>>> aktuelle Position des Cursors an, bis ich auf die Idee kam, (auch) die
>>>>>>> Wortzahl anzuzeigen. Der eingefügte Schnipsel in die vimrc zeigte dann
>>>>>>> aber *nur* die Wortzahl an.
>>>>>>> set statusline+=%{wordcount().words}\ words
>>>>>>> set laststatus=2    " enables the statusline.
>>>>>>> Nun war mir die aktuelle Zeilenzahl und Position des Cursors doch
>>>>>>> wieder
>>>>>>> wichtiger, dass ich beide Zeilen auskommentierte. Nun wird nichts mehr
>>>>>>> angezeigt.
>>>>>> Wenn du laststatus nicht setzt, gibt es auch keine statusline
>>>>>
>>>>> Auch wenn nur "set laststatus=2" allein gesetzt ist, wird keine angezeigt.
>>>>
>>>> Was passiert mit
>>>> :set statusline?
>>>>
>>>> Meine statusline in vimrc
>>>> set statusline=%F%m%r%h%w%=(Z\ %l\/%L,\ Sp\ %c)\ %P
>>>>
>>>> ergibt z.B.
>>>> ~/.vim/vimrc[+]                     (Z 142/264, Sp 1) 55%
>>> Invertiert:
>>> [No Name][+]
>>> wenn auch
>>> set laststatus=2
>>> gesetzt ist. Sonst gar nichts.
>>>
>> Natürlich.
>>
>> Welche VIM Version setzt du ein?
>> Bei mir VIM 8.2 klappt deine Änderung.
> 
> | Vi IMproved 8.2 (2019 Dec 12, compiled Mar 02 2021 02:58:09)
> 
> Das scheint alt. Aber ist so neu, wie Debian (Testing) es vorhält.
> 
> Vermutlich müsste ich die vimrc entfernen. Unter einem anderen
> User-Account zeigt VIM die Zahl der Zeilen und Charakter an.
> 
> Egal, ich ignoriere das. Will nicht wirklich zu viel Zeit dafür
> aufbringen. Dachte, es gäbe eine *einfache* Lösung.

Gibt es: einfach im Normalmode g ctl-g  eingeben, dann erscheint die
Dateistatistik.


[toc] | [prev] | [next] | [standalone]


#368

FromAndreas Kohlbach <ank@spamfence.net>
Date2021-08-26 20:13 -0400
Message-ID<875yvrzqwf.fsf@usenet.ankman.de>
In reply to#367
On Thu, 26 Aug 2021 20:37:37 +0200, nospam_2021@efbe.prima.de wrote:
>
> Am 26.08.21 um 18:32 schrieb Andreas Kohlbach:
>> On Thu, 26 Aug 2021 11:19:40 +0200, nospam_2021@efbe.prima.de wrote:
>>>
>>> Welche VIM Version setzt du ein?
>>> Bei mir VIM 8.2 klappt deine Änderung.
>> 
>> | Vi IMproved 8.2 (2019 Dec 12, compiled Mar 02 2021 02:58:09)
>> 
>> Das scheint alt. Aber ist so neu, wie Debian (Testing) es vorhält.
>> 
>> Vermutlich müsste ich die vimrc entfernen. Unter einem anderen
>> User-Account zeigt VIM die Zahl der Zeilen und Charakter an.
>> 
>> Egal, ich ignoriere das. Will nicht wirklich zu viel Zeit dafür
>> aufbringen. Dachte, es gäbe eine *einfache* Lösung.
>
> Gibt es: einfach im Normalmode g ctl-g  eingeben, dann erscheint die
> Dateistatistik.

Danke Dir.
-- 
Andreas

PGP fingerprint 952B0A9F12C2FD6C9F7E68DAA9C2EA89D1A370E0

[toc] | [prev] | [standalone]


Back to top | Article view | de.comp.editoren


csiph-web